
What Is Electrical Infrastructure Development?
Electrical infrastructure development includes the construction, expansion, modernization, and restoration of power systems that generate, transmit, distribute, and control electricity. These projects can range from utility-scale builds to industrial facility upgrades.
Common electrical infrastructure work includes:
-
New substation builds and expansions
-
Transmission and distribution support scope
-
Industrial power upgrades and equipment installations
-
Outage support for shutdown work and tie-ins
-
Structural and civil work that supports electrical systems
-
Reliability improvements and modernization projects
Why Electrical Infrastructure Development Matters
Aging assets, rising demand, and stricter safety expectations are pushing utilities and industrial facilities to invest in stronger systems. The right infrastructure development strategy can deliver:
- Greater reliability and fewer interruptions
- Improved safety for workers and communities
- Higher capacity to support expansion and load growth
- Better efficiency and reduced long-term maintenance costs
- Faster recovery after failures or extreme weather events
Whether you’re supporting a growing service area or improving plant performance, infrastructure development is a long-term investment in uptime and resilience.

1) Substation Construction and Modernization
Substations are essential nodes in the power network stepping voltage up/down and protecting equipment. Substation projects often require precise installation, strict safety controls, and careful sequencing.
Typical scope support includes:
- Site preparation and structural work support
- Equipment setting and installation support
- Expansions for new bays or upgraded capacity
- Modernization of aging infrastructure for improved reliability

Common Challenges in Electrical Infrastructure Development
Electrical infrastructure projects require specialized execution due to:
- Complex interfaces between civil, structural, and electrical scope
- Restricted access and energized-area hazards
- Tight schedules, especially during outages
- High quality standards before energization
- Coordination across multiple contractors and stakeholders
A contractor with disciplined work practices helps reduce rework, delays, and safety incidents.
